Robin Wright plays Laura, an art gallery owner who becomes obsessed with her son Daniel (Laurie Davidson) after the death of her daughter.
Olivia Cooke plays Cherry, Daniel's girlfriend, who Laura suspects of having ulterior motives.
The series is based on the novel by Michelle Frances but features a different ending designed to shock viewers.
The show is a soapy thriller that offers twists and turns.
'The Girlfriend' splits each episode into two parts, showing the same events from Laura's and Cherry's perspectives, revealing omissions and biases. The series explores themes of class differences and the ways money affects the characters' motivations and actions. As the narrative progresses, the performances become more intense, leading to a dramatic power struggle. The series offers a blend of suspense and soapy drama, with Wright and Cooke delivering compelling performances.
